This lets you know how urgent your housing need is and how quickly you will move up the wigan council housing waiting list. Each council can also decide who else gets priority within its area, and how much priority they get. If you need housing immediately (for example if your current home is unsafe, or you are homeless) the council may have a duty to help you immediately. If you have previously had your priority taken away but your circumstances have now changed (for example, you have cleared your rent arrears, or, the person who was involved in anti-social behaviour has now left), then you can ask to make a fresh application. If the council decides that your priority should be taken away, they should write and tell you. If the council believes that you, or any member of your household, have been involved in behaviour that is serious enough to make you unsuitable to be a council tenant, they can take away any priority you have been given. If the council decides not to accept your application to go on its waiting list, it must write to you and explain the legal reasons for its decision.
